Tail Light replacement DIY link?
 
Walked into my garage with tools and Mr. Bentley - but found the manual doesn't cover rear tail light replacement - just bulbs.

With all the de-amber mods - must be a posted DIY somewhere.

look inside your trunk,
there are four screws (located at the corners) holding the tail light in place
You might have to pull away the carpet a bit
pop off the plate which hold the bulbs (covered in maintenance manual - look under replacing bulbs)

that's all there is...

This is really easy. There are a couple plastic trim pieces that hold carpet up on each side. Find them and take them out, then you have complete access to the light hardware.

Took all of about 20 minutes to do both. Trust me, very easy and about the best mod you can do for under 250 bucks besides de-snorkeling!!
